Bayern Munich winger Serge Gnabry has named former three team-mates who helped him during his time with Arsenal.
The German international fired himself back into the headlines this week when he scored four times for Bayern Munich during their 7-2 win over Tottenham in north London.
Gnabry told The Athletic of Robin van Persie: “He always told me to go for it.
“That I could do it when I got my first few minutes on the pitch.
“As a young player, his words meant a lot to me.
“He was a great help, as were Mesut [Ozil] and Lukas [Podolski]. They encouraged me by telling me about their problems and giving useful advice.
“I was lucky that I could learn from them."
“As much as I loved Arsenal and being in London, I realised that I needed to play regularly."
